Exciting news for New Orleans musicians! City council has passed an ordinance to establish the first uniform minimum wage for performers at city-run events and festivals. Musicians will now earn at least $200 per hour, with larger acts receiving a flat rate of $2,000 per performance. This move aims to ensure fair pay, boost the local economy, and enhance the quality of life for our talented artists. The ordinance is set to take effect in January 2025. #METRONOME #MakingMusicMakeMoney #SupportLocalArtists ⚜️💸
